That's a perfect explanation of the top-slide angle for threading :) Very impressed with the re-registration of the chuck :thumbup: Finishing cuts are always a sod (at least that's the way I find them ;) ) I was taught to give the tool a light wipe with a fine stone prior to the final cut to clear any tiny bits of swarf sticking to the cutting edge (I use a diamond lap for carbide inserts). Don't be afraid to polish the job - sometimes it's the only way to get a finish. BTW The Hardinge spindle lock has 6 positions which are very handy for quick indexing 2 or 3 radial positions.
